Structures
Trial Chambers
- Trial Chambers are a new structure in the Overworld where players can explore and take on combat challenges
- Made out of a variety of Copper and Tuff blocks, and can be found in different sizes
- A relatively common find throughout the Deepslate layer of the underground
- Natural mob spawning does not occur inside, similar to Ancient Cities
- Never starts inside a Deep Dark biome, but can sometimes overlap it
- The layout of each Trial Chamber is procedurally generated, and can include traps, rewards and a variety of combat areas
- Decorated Pots line the corridors and hold hidden treasures
- Supply Barrels can be found between different rooms, and give you blocks and items which help you navigate your trials
- Vaults are guarded by challenges in each room, and can be a source of many high level Enchanted Books and equipment including a very rare chance to receive a Trident
- Ominous Vaults can be found in harder to reach places and give even better loot than standard Vaults, including some items which are exclusive to Ominous Vaults
- Each Trial Chamber will include Trial Spawners with a melee, small melee, or ranged category:
- Melee
- Zombie
- Husk
- Spider
- Small Melee
- Slime
- Cave Spider
- Baby Zombie
- Silverfish
- Ranged
- Skeleton
- Stray
- Bogged
- Melee
- Each Trial Spawner category will only use one mob for the entire structure when generated, and these mobs are randomized for each Trial Chamber
- For example, one Trial Chamber might only spawn Zombies, Cave Spiders and Strays, while another might only spawn Spiders, Silverfish and Skeletons
- The exceptions to this are some Trial Spawners in unique rooms which always spawn Breezes
Mobs
Breeze
- A cunning hostile mob spawned by some Trial Spawners in Trial Chamber rooms
- Drops 1-2 Breeze Rods when killed by a player
- The number of Breeze Rods dropped is affected by looting enchantments
- Moves primarily by leaping around its target
- Deflects almost all projectiles, making it immune to ranged combat
- With one notable exception: it cannot deflect Wind Charges
- An aggressive adversary, it shoots volatile wind energy in the form of Wind Charge projectiles at its target
- After colliding with an entity or a block, Wind Charge projectiles produce a Wind Burst, which knocks back entities in the area
- Wind Charges deal a small amount of damage when colliding directly with an entity
- Wind Charges break decorated pots and chorus flower blocks upon collision
- Wind Bursts have the effect of ‘activating’ certain blocks:
- Non-Iron Doors and Trapdoors are flipped
- Fence Gates are flipped
- Buttons are pressed
- Levers are flipped
- Bells are rung and swung
- Lit Candles are extinguished
- Wind Bursts do not have any effect on Iron Doors, Iron Trapdoors, or any block being held in its position by a Redstone signal
- Will not retaliate against attacks from the following mobs: Skeletons, Strays, Bogged, Zombies, Husks, Spiders, Cave Spiders and Slimes
- The same mobs will not retaliate against a Breeze when hurt by its Wind Charge projectile
Bogged
- A new variant of Skeletons that shoots poisonous arrows
- They’re easier to take down with 16 health instead of 20 health
- They attack at a slower interval of 3.5 seconds instead of 2 seconds
- Has a chance to drop Arrows of Poison when killed by players
- These mossy and mushroom covered Skeletons spawn naturally in Swamps and Mangrove Swamps
- Can also be found spawning from Trial Spawners in some Trial Chambers
- Drops 2 mushrooms when sheared (either both red, both brown, or one of each)
Experimental Features
Ominous Trials
- A new Ominous Event that can be accessed by exploring a Trial Chamber with Bad Omen
- This event will have players facing more powerful Trial Spawners, if they dare!
- Please note: There are some changes that are already in the Java Edition Snapshot that haven’t made it here, but we are working on more tweaks that will be included in the upcoming Previews.
Ominous Bottle
- An item which can be consumed by players to receive the Bad Omen effect for 1 hour and 40 minutes
- Comes in 5 variations, one for each Bad Omen level
- The bottle breaks when consumed
- Can be stacked to 64
- Can be found uncommonly in any Vaults that are unlocked with Trial Keys, and is dropped by Raid Captains when defeated outside a Raid
Ominous Trial Key
- A new variant of the Trial Key which can only be obtained by defeating an Ominous Trial Spawner
- They can be used to unlock Ominous Vaults
Ominous Trial Spawner
- A more powerful active phase of the Trial Spawner with unique challenges and rewards
- Provides a more challenging experience that players can opt into for better rewards
- If a Trial Spawner detects a player that has the Trial Omen effect, the spawner will become Ominous if:
- It is not in cooldown
- It is in cooldown but was not Ominous during its last activation
- Making it Ominous this way will bypass the cooldown
- While active, it will:
- Glow blue instead of orange
- Emit soul flames instead of normal flames
- More commonly spawn mobs with equipment if they can wear it
- The equipment these mobs wear have Armor Trims applied from the Trial Chambers
- Periodically spawn potions and projectiles on top of unsuspecting players and mobs
- Becoming Ominous will despawn any existing mobs it spawned and reset its challenge
- It will stay Ominous until it has been defeated and its cooldown has finished
- When defeated, it will eject a different set of loot than normal Trial Spawners
Ominous Vault
- A variant of Vaults that have a different texture and emit soul flames instead of normal flames
- These can be found throughout the Trial Chambers in harder to find places and require an Ominous Trial Key to unlock
- These Vaults hold a more valuable set of rewards than the standard Vaults unlocked by Trial Keys
- Known Issue: Vaults in Trial Chambers may generate without loot and cannot be opened by Trial Key
Ominous Events
- Bad Omen has been expanded to give access to an optional experience in Trial Chambers
- These optional experiences accessed through Bad Omen are now known as Ominous Events
- They are more challenging than usual, and are designed to shake up the experience in unique ways
- Illager Raids are an example of an existing Ominous Event
- Bad Omen is getting some changes with this redesign:
- It has a new, shadowy icon and a sound for being applied to the player
- It is no longer given to players that defeat a Raid Captain outside a Raid
- Instead, players can gain access to Bad Omen by consuming a new Ominous Bottle
Trial Omen
- A variant that Bad Omen can transform into
- This occurs when the player is within detection range of a Trial Spawner that is not Ominous
- The transformed Trial Omen has a duration of 15 minutes multiplied by the previous Bad Omen level
- Players that have Trial Omen are surrounded by ominous particles
Mob Effects
- The following effects have been added:
- Wind Charged
- Affected entities will emit a wind burst upon death
- Brewed with an Awkward Potion and a Breeze Rod
- Weaving
- Affected entities will spread Cobweb blocks upon death
- Non-player entities with this effect can walk through Cobweb at normal speeds
- Brewed with an Awkward Potion and a Cobweb block
- Oozing
- Affected entities will spawn two Slimes upon death
- Brewed with an Awkward Potion and a Slime Block
- Infested
- Affected entities have a 5% chance to spawn 1-2 Silverfish when hurt
- Brewed with an Awkward Potion and a Stone block
- These effects can be encountered while taking on an Ominous Trial Spawner
- Spawners in an area will select a unique effect for the duration of their challenge, and drop them as lingering potions onto mobs and players nearby
- Some mobs are immune to these effects
- Slimes are immune to Oozing
- Silverfish are immune to Infested
- Known issue: The duration of these mob effects is different to Java Edition and will be fixed soon

Blocks
- Cauldrons filled with potions now keep the color of the potion when pushed by a Piston
- Containers being cloned over no longer keep their container screens open and cause crashes
- The “tallgrass” block is now split into unique instances “short_grass” and “fern”
- Items drops from blocks destroyed in an explosion now get merged into bigger item stacks before spawning in the world
- All blocks now drop items by default when exploded with TNT (MCPE-56036)
- Added a new game rule to control decay of drops from TNT explosions, named “tntExplosionDropDecay”
- The rule can be set to “true” to re-enable the previous behavior where not all blocks would drop when exploded by TNT
Boat
- Player can now stand on Boats that float on water (MCPE-105535) (MCPE-120687)

Mobs
- Naturally spawning mobs now spawn at the center of a Block (MCPE-99315) In this beta we updated natural mob spawns to have mobs spawn at the center of a block instead of at the corner of a block. This fixes many issues where mobs could not spawn on slopes, in narrow passageways and in other situations where they were expected to. For technical players, this bug fix will mean that some player-made mob farms no longer fully work. We appreciate the time the community puts into building clever farms and we try to avoid breaking farms when we can. In this case, we felt that this change was necessary because it improves the way spawning works in many biomes.
